This episode originally aired on March 22, 2022.---Samuel Colt's name is forever linked to the company he founded and the revolver he called the “Peacemaker.” Born in Connecticut in 1814, he was steeped in America's gun culture from an early age. His grandfather had served in George Washington's army, and Samuel inherited an old flintlock pistol from the family hero when he was only six. At the age of fifteen, while working in his father's textile plant, he built a galvanic cell (basically an early battery) and used it to set off explosives beneath the surface of a nearby pond during the Fourth of July. He continued to experiment with chemicals and combustion—as many young men do—and became fascinated by inventors' work to create a firearm that could shoot more than bullets before needing to reload.Join us as we teach you about Samuel Colt, Richard Gatling, and John Browning.     [Rediff] Instagram a déployé en 2025 plusieurs fonctionnalités majeures de partage qui transforment l'expérience utilisateur de la plateforme. Ces nouveautés s'articulent autour de trois axes principaux : les reposts, la carte des amis et l'onglet Amis.La Fonctionnalité Repost : Le Partage Natif Enfin DisponibleLa fonctionnalité Repost permet désormais de repartager directement les publications publiques d'autres utilisateurs. Cette nouveauté, largement réclamée par la communauté, fonctionne de manière similaire au retweet de Twitter.Comment utiliser le Repost :Une nouvelle icône (représentant deux flèches circulaires) apparaît sous chaque publication publique, à côté des boutons « J'aime » et « Commenter » Appuyez sur l'icône pour repartager un Reel, une photo ou un carrousel Ajouter un commentaire personnel : Vous pouvez ajouter une note explicative dans la bulle de commentaire qui apparaît Le contenu reposté apparaît dans votre fil d'actualité et dans un onglet dédié « Reposts » sur votre profil Les reposts bénéficient de plusieurs avantages en termes de visibilité :Attribution automatique au créateur original avec lien cliquable Recommandation aux abonnés de celui qui repartage, même s'ils ne suivent pas le créateur initial Archivage permanent dans l'onglet « Reposts » du profil Suppression possible à tout moment depuis l'onglet dédié —Quels usages de la fonction repost pour les marques ? La fonctionnalité Repost d'Instagram transforme radicalement les possibilités de marketing pour les marques. Elle offre de nouveaux leviers pour amplifier leur présence et créer des synergies avec les communautés. Écosystème d'Ambassadeurs : Une Nouvelle Dimension CollaborativeLes marques peuvent désormais structurer leurs programmes autour de la réciprocité du partage. Contrairement aux collaborations traditionnelles où seule la marque bénéficie de la visibilité, le Repost crée une dynamique gagnant-gagnant.Co-amplification : L'ambassadeur reposte les contenus de la marque, la marque reposte ceux de l'ambassadeurCrédibilité renforcée : L'ambassadeur gagne en légitimité en étant featured par la marque. La marque gagne en incarnation.—Marketing d'Influence : Des Collaborations Plus AuthentiquesLa fonction repost se trouve être un outil complémentaire au post collab.Je peux compléter mes campagnes d'influence en demandant l'intégration de repos de contenu de marque ou en reportant moi même du contenu UGC produit par un influenceur.A noter que les repost d'influenceurs génèrent des performances supérieures aux contenus de marque traditionnels :70% d'engagement supplémentaire pour le contenu UGC repostéhttps://sproutbox.co/instagrams-new-repost-feature-how-it-impacts-your-business/Taux de completion plus élevés grâce à l'authenticité perçue Portée étendue sans coût publicitaire additionnel—Levier de Visibilité Communautaire : transformer son compte en Hub de Co-créationStratégies de curation communautaire :User-Generated Content (UGC) : Republier les créations des clients Témoignages authentiques : Partager les retours spontanés Lifestyle content : Montrer les produits en situation réelleGestion de la Cohérence de MarqueLes marques doivent développer des guidelines de curation pour maintenir la cohérence tout en encourageant la diversité des contenus repostés.—Jeux Concours : Nouvelles Mécaniques d'EngagementLa fonction Repost ouvre de nouvelles possibilités créatives pour les jeux concours Instagram, dépassant les traditionnels « like + tag ». Les marques peuvent maintenant intégrer le partage permanent dans leurs mécaniques de participation. « Repostez ce contenu pour participer »—Certaines restrictions s'appliquent à cette fonctionnalité :Seuls les contenus publics peuvent être repostés Les comptes privés ne peuvent pas voir leurs publications repartagées Les utilisateurs peuvent désactiver la possibilité de repost via leurs paramètres de confidentialité Hébergé par Acast.     In this podcast repost, we rediscover the work of Pediatric Gastroenterologist Dr. Alessio Fasano from the Massachusettes General Hospital Department of Pediatric Gastroenterology. In this conversation, we discussed the research on Intestinal Permeability, Microbiomes and MIS, Multi Inflammatory Syndrome in Children . Dr. Fasano also directs the Mucosal Immunology and Biology Research Center and is associate chief for Basic, Clinical and Translational Research. Under his leadership, investigators are studying the molecular mechanisms of autoimmune disorders including celiac disease, and other-gluten-related disorders. He has been named visiting professor of pediatrics at Harvard Medical School. He authored the groundbreaking study in 2003 that established the rate of celiac disease at one in 133 Americans. Widely sought after by national and international media, Dr. Fasano has been featured in hundreds of interviews including outlets such as The New York Times, The Wall Street Journal; National Public Radio; CNN; Bloomberg News, and others.     In "Trimble's Perspective: The Future of Freight is Connected", Joe Lynch and Rob Painter, Trimble's President and Chief Executive Officer, discuss how Trimble connects the freight ecosystem—people, data, and workflows—to navigate the difficult truckload market and drive customer efficiency using AI and integrated commercial solutions. About Rob Painter Rob Painter became Trimble's president and chief executive officer in January 2020. From 2016 through 2019, he served as the Company's chief financial officer. Joining the Company in 2006, Painter held a variety of leadership positions, including corporate development, corporate strategy, general manager of Construction Services, general manager of the Intelligent Construction Tools international joint venture, and vice president of Trimble Buildings construction software. In August 2023, he was appointed to serve on the Synopsys Board of Directors. Painter holds a bachelor's degree in finance from West Virginia University and an MBA from Harvard University. About Trimble Transportation Trimble Transportation provides fleets with solutions to create a fully integrated supply chain. With an intelligent ecosystem of products and services, Trimble Transportation enables customers to embrace the rapid technological evolution of the industry and connect all aspects of transportation and logistics — trucks, drivers, back office, freight and assets. Trimble Transportation delivers an open, scalable platform to help customers make more informed decisions and maximize performance, visibility and safety. Key Takeaways: Trimble's Perspective: The Future of Freight is Connected In "Trimble's Perspective: The Future of Freight is Connected", Joe Lynch and Rob Painter, Trimble's President and Chief Executive Officer, discuss how Trimble connects the freight ecosystem—people, data, and workflows—to navigate the difficult truckload market and drive customer efficiency using AI and integrated commercial solutions. Holistic Solution for a Difficult Truckload Market: Trimble's T&L segment directly addresses the pressures of the current truckload market by providing core operational platforms (TMW.Suite, TruckMate) to help carriers, shippers, and brokers manage operations, accounting, and dispatch, ensuring maximum efficiency and cost control when margins are tight. Driving Strategy with the Connect & Scale Message: The entire product portfolio—spanning TMS, maintenance, visibility, and procurement—is structured to embody Trimble's "Connect & Scale" message, which focuses on integrating people, data, and workflows into a unified ecosystem to drive growth and efficiency. AI-Powered Autonomous Freight Procurement: Trimble is leveraging AI within its Freight Procurement solutions (Transporeon, Freight Marketplace) to move toward autonomous procurement. This helps shippers and brokers efficiently source capacity and optimize freight spend in real-time, which is critical in a volatile capacity environment. Commercial Mapping for Efficiency and Safety: Essential tools like Trimble MAPS (CoPilot, Appian) go beyond basic navigation. They provide commercial-grade routing that accounts for truck-specific constraints and HOS, acting as a crucial element in optimizing routes and protecting drivers (part of the people and workflow components of Connect & Scale). TMS as the Core Workflow Integrator: Comprehensive Transportation Management Systems (TMS) platforms like TMW.Suite act as the central brain for workflows, integrating data across the business from operations to financial accounting, which is foundational to the "Scale" component of Trimble's strategy. Proactive Maintenance and Data Connectivity: Solutions for Asset & Fleet Maintenance focus on maximizing uptime—a key lever in today's market. By using data from connected trucks (fault codes, location) for preventative and predictive maintenance, they ensure assets remain productive and reduce unexpected downtime. Regulatory Compliance and Risk Mitigation (People & Data): The Safety & Compliance offerings help fleets mitigate risk and adhere to federal regulations, ensuring the safety and legal operation of their people (drivers) and assets, proving that technology is essential for responsible management and effective use of operational data.     Mark Sponsler grew up on an avocado farm outside Miami. One day an avocado ricocheted off his window shutters during a storm, and something clicked. He's been obsessed with weather ever since. He graduated from Rollins College in 1980 with a degree in Business Administration, then spent years managing software projects for companies like Rockwell International and Lockheed-Martin. Not exactly the resume you'd expect from the guy who predicts Mavericks swells down to the hour. In 1998, Mark launched Stormsurf. It started as an email thread between local surfers. Now it's the source big-wave surfers actually trust. Stormsurf has consulted on IMAX films, Nightline, 48 Hours, and was the lead forecasting source for the movie Chasing Mavericks.
